.biometric-btn.svelte-pjd24n{display:flex;align-items:center;justify-content:center;gap:12px;width:100%;padding:14px 20px;background:transparent;border:2px solid var(--swiss-black, #1a1a1a);color:var(--swiss-black, #1a1a1a);font-family:inherit;font-size:14px;font-weight:600;cursor:pointer;transition:all .15s ease}.biometric-btn.svelte-pjd24n:hover:not(:disabled){background:var(--swiss-black, #1a1a1a);color:var(--swiss-white, #fafafa)}.biometric-btn.svelte-pjd24n:disabled{opacity:.5;cursor:not-allowed}.biometric-icon.svelte-pjd24n{width:24px;height:24px;flex-shrink:0}.biometric-spinner.svelte-pjd24n{width:20px;height:20px;border:2px solid currentColor;border-top-color:transparent;border-radius:50%;animation:svelte-pjd24n-spin .8s linear infinite}@keyframes svelte-pjd24n-spin{to{transform:rotate(360deg)}}.share-container.svelte-vhe9p8{position:relative;display:inline-block}.share-btn.svelte-vhe9p8{display:flex;align-items:center;justify-content:center;gap:8px;background:transparent;border:2px solid var(--swiss-black, #1a1a1a);color:var(--swiss-black, #1a1a1a);font-family:inherit;cursor:pointer;transition:all .15s ease}.share-btn.svelte-vhe9p8:hover{background:var(--swiss-black, #1a1a1a);color:var(--swiss-white, #fafafa)}.share-btn.svelte-vhe9p8 svg:where(.svelte-vhe9p8){width:20px;height:20px}.share-btn-icon.svelte-vhe9p8{padding:10px}.share-btn-text.svelte-vhe9p8{padding:8px 16px;font-size:14px;font-weight:600;border:none;text-decoration:underline}.share-btn-full.svelte-vhe9p8{padding:12px 20px;font-size:14px;font-weight:600}.share-menu.svelte-vhe9p8{position:absolute;top:100%;right:0;margin-top:8px;background:var(--swiss-white, #fafafa);border:2px solid var(--swiss-black, #1a1a1a);min-width:180px;z-index:100;box-shadow:4px 4px 0 var(--swiss-black, #1a1a1a)}.share-menu-item.svelte-vhe9p8{display:flex;align-items:center;gap:12px;width:100%;padding:12px 16px;background:transparent;border:none;border-bottom:1px solid var(--swiss-gray, #e5e5e5);color:var(--swiss-black, #1a1a1a);font-family:inherit;font-size:14px;font-weight:500;text-decoration:none;cursor:pointer;transition:background .15s}.share-menu-item.svelte-vhe9p8:last-child{border-bottom:none}.share-menu-item.svelte-vhe9p8:hover{background:var(--swiss-gray, #e5e5e5)}.share-menu-item.svelte-vhe9p8 svg:where(.svelte-vhe9p8){width:18px;height:18px;flex-shrink:0}.share-backdrop.svelte-vhe9p8{position:fixed;top:0;right:0;bottom:0;left:0;background:transparent;border:none;cursor:default;z-index:99}.share-toast.svelte-vhe9p8{position:fixed;bottom:24px;left:50%;transform:translate(-50%);background:var(--swiss-black, #1a1a1a);color:var(--swiss-white, #fafafa);padding:12px 24px;font-size:14px;font-weight:600;z-index:1000;animation:svelte-vhe9p8-toast-in .2s ease}@keyframes svelte-vhe9p8-toast-in{0%{opacity:0;transform:translate(-50%) translateY(10px)}to{opacity:1;transform:translate(-50%) translateY(0)}}.offline-banner.svelte-10qza8d{position:fixed;bottom:0;left:0;right:0;background:var(--swiss-black, #1a1a1a);color:var(--swiss-white, #fafafa);padding:12px 16px;z-index:9999;animation:svelte-10qza8d-slide-up .3s ease}.offline-content.svelte-10qza8d{display:flex;align-items:center;justify-content:center;gap:12px;max-width:1200px;margin:0 auto}.offline-icon.svelte-10qza8d{width:20px;height:20px;flex-shrink:0}.offline-text.svelte-10qza8d{font-size:14px;font-weight:600}.offline-queue.svelte-10qza8d{font-weight:400;opacity:.8}.update-banner.svelte-10qza8d{position:fixed;top:0;left:0;right:0;background:#2563eb;color:#fff;padding:12px 16px;display:flex;align-items:center;justify-content:center;gap:16px;z-index:9999;animation:svelte-10qza8d-slide-down .3s ease}.update-btn.svelte-10qza8d{background:#fff;color:#2563eb;border:none;padding:6px 16px;font-size:14px;font-weight:600;cursor:pointer;transition:opacity .15s}.update-btn.svelte-10qza8d:hover{opacity:.9}@keyframes svelte-10qza8d-slide-up{0%{transform:translateY(100%)}to{transform:translateY(0)}}@keyframes svelte-10qza8d-slide-down{0%{transform:translateY(-100%)}to{transform:translateY(0)}}@supports (padding-bottom: env(safe-area-inset-bottom)){.offline-banner.svelte-10qza8d{padding-bottom:calc(12px + env(safe-area-inset-bottom))}}.push-toggle.svelte-1wr6fmb{display:flex;align-items:center;justify-content:space-between;gap:16px;padding:16px 0;border-bottom:1px solid var(--swiss-gray, #e5e5e5)}.push-info.svelte-1wr6fmb{flex:1}.push-label.svelte-1wr6fmb{font-size:15px;font-weight:600;color:var(--swiss-black, #1a1a1a);margin-bottom:4px}.push-description.svelte-1wr6fmb{font-size:13px;color:var(--swiss-gray-dark, #666);line-height:1.4}.push-control.svelte-1wr6fmb{flex-shrink:0}.push-status.svelte-1wr6fmb{font-size:13px;font-weight:500;padding:6px 12px}.push-status-unavailable.svelte-1wr6fmb{color:var(--swiss-gray-dark, #666);background:var(--swiss-gray, #e5e5e5)}.push-status-blocked.svelte-1wr6fmb{color:#dc2626;background:#fef2f2}.toggle-switch.svelte-1wr6fmb{position:relative;width:52px;height:28px;background:var(--swiss-gray, #e5e5e5);border:none;border-radius:14px;cursor:pointer;transition:background .2s}.toggle-switch.active.svelte-1wr6fmb{background:#22c55e}.toggle-switch.svelte-1wr6fmb:disabled{opacity:.5;cursor:not-allowed}.toggle-slider.svelte-1wr6fmb{position:absolute;top:2px;left:2px;width:24px;height:24px;background:#fff;border-radius:50%;box-shadow:0 2px 4px #0003;transition:transform .2s}.toggle-switch.active.svelte-1wr6fmb .toggle-slider:where(.svelte-1wr6fmb){transform:translate(24px)}.camera-capture.svelte-1ns995y{display:flex;flex-direction:column;gap:12px}.capture-btn.svelte-1ns995y,.upload-btn.svelte-1ns995y{display:flex;align-items:center;justify-content:center;gap:12px;width:100%;padding:16px 24px;font-family:inherit;font-size:15px;font-weight:600;cursor:pointer;transition:all .15s ease}.capture-btn.svelte-1ns995y{background:var(--swiss-black, #1a1a1a);color:var(--swiss-white, #fafafa);border:none}.capture-btn.svelte-1ns995y:hover:not(:disabled){background:#333}.upload-btn.svelte-1ns995y{background:transparent;color:var(--swiss-black, #1a1a1a);border:2px solid var(--swiss-black, #1a1a1a)}.upload-btn.svelte-1ns995y:hover:not(:disabled){background:var(--swiss-gray, #e5e5e5)}.capture-btn.svelte-1ns995y:disabled,.upload-btn.svelte-1ns995y:disabled{opacity:.5;cursor:not-allowed}.capture-btn.svelte-1ns995y svg:where(.svelte-1ns995y),.upload-btn.svelte-1ns995y svg:where(.svelte-1ns995y){width:22px;height:22px;flex-shrink:0}.capture-spinner.svelte-1ns995y{width:22px;height:22px;border:2px solid currentColor;border-top-color:transparent;border-radius:50%;animation:svelte-1ns995y-spin .8s linear infinite}@keyframes svelte-1ns995y-spin{to{transform:rotate(360deg)}}@media (min-width: 640px){.camera-capture.svelte-1ns995y{flex-direction:row}.capture-btn.svelte-1ns995y,.upload-btn.svelte-1ns995y{flex:1}}
